ITT Interconnect Solutions will be showcasing its latest connector developed for the rail industry at the Ferroviaria rail exhibition in Turin, Italy, from 8-10 June 2010.

The VEAM CIR-M12 Databus connector has been designed to enable different data types to be transmitted between railway carriages via a single connector.

Ethernet, MVB, WTB and video lines can all be bundled within the same interconnect, so diverse data feeds such as engine diagnostics, brake controls, environmental conditioning, passenger display systems, networking and lighting control all pass through it.

The design was achieved by integrating four conductor wires and the associated braid from shielded cables into Quadrax QXM12 contacts, mounting them into FRCIR circular bayonet connector hardware and utilising a plastic insert to group the multiple contacts and their cables together.

The CIR-M12 Databus connector can withstand operating temperatures of -40 to 125C.
